中文摘要:
      摘 要:放射性核素示踪技术原理主要基于放射性示踪剂与被测研究物质具有相同的化学性质和生物学行为,即同一性和示踪剂在生物体系或外部环境的代谢转化过程中其放射性核素自发衰变放出射线可被探测和记录,即可测性。因此,核医学核素示踪体外分析、功能测定、显像及靶向治疗是无创、安全的,且可提供精确的定性、定量和定位信息,可用于疾病的早期诊断与治疗。
英文摘要:
      Abstract:Radionuclide tracing technique is mainly based on the principle of material to be measured with radioactive tracer with the nature of the chemical and biological behavior of the same,that is the same and the tracer is transformed in the biological system or the external environment in the metabolism of radionuclide decay spontaneously emitting radiation can be detected and recorded. Therefore,the analysis of radionuclide tracing in vitro,functional examination,imaging and target therapy is a noninvasive,safe and could provide qualitative,quantitative and accurate positioning information,also could be used for early diagnosis and treatment of disease.
